2. 1973 Preston
Preston Hockey Club's first team, who were successful in their opening North West League match of the season with a 1-0 win over Timperley. Seated (left to right): D Maddocks, D Burton, A Blackburn (captain), R Haggie, K Hutton. Standing: J Hide, M Banahan, R Evans, P Forrest, J Gibson, P Smith, C Lavery Photo: RETRO
3. 1973 Preston
Fanciers from many parts of the North West attended the homing pigeon auction sale held at Frecnhwood Social Club in Bence Road, Preston, in aid of the local Samaritans branch. Pictured Gerry Hothersall (left) secretary of the North West Lancs Federation, and auctioneer Brian Whittle discuss one of the birds with Mrs Forshaw, chairman of the Preston Samaritans Photo: RETRO
4. 1973 Preston
Soccer's bad boys might well benefit from a visit to the side streets of Preston to see how the game should be played. During August eight teams have been fighting it out in an inter-street football contest. Pictured - the toss-up before the start of the match between Bootle Street 'A' and Brand Road Photo: RETRO
